二、ts 面向对象编程(简易版)

(一) 类的声明和使用

 

 

(二) 修饰符

类中属性的访问可以用访问修饰符来进行限制。访问修饰符分为:public、protected、private。

  • public:公有修饰符,可以在类内或者类外使用public修饰的属性或者行为,默认修饰符。
  • protected:受保护的修饰符,可以本类和子类中使用protected修饰的属性和行为。
  • private : 私有修饰符,只可以在类内使用private修饰的属性和行为。

     

 

 

 

 使用readonly修饰符将属性设置为只读,只读属性必须在生命时或者构造函数里被初始化(注意)。

    

 

 

 

 

 

(三) 继承和重写

 

 

(四) 接口

(五) 命名空间

 

     在制作大型应用的时候,为了让程序更加有层次感和变量之间不互相干扰,我们可以使用命名空间来构建程序。

 

 

(六) 其他

Typescript的语法和ES6的有很多都一样,比如说promise,async/await等。

 

posted @ 2020-10-14 15:41  CatherLee  阅读(748)  评论(0编辑  收藏  举报